About This Property
You will love this house! This is a truly unique home, on the National Historic Registry, and yet, updated for a modern life! An Outstanding Federal/Greek Revival, c.1830's once owned by James Ellsworth and moved to its current site during Ellsworth's restoration of Hudson in early 1900's. Historians & century home enthusiasts believe home to be a splendid specimen w/heavy pegged timber construction, a lunette, corner boards & 12 over 12 window glass panes on 1st flr. Ellsworth called 233 Aurora cottage #1 where his mother lived and later his daughter. A charming screened in porch was added w/brick floor, new custom cabinet/wet bar & mounted TV. Fam rm addition w/fp and wall of shelving. New white custom kit 2018 w/large center island breakfast bar, quartz countertops, custom lighting, high end stainless appliances, exposed beams-beautiful! 25' x 14' living room w/fp, stunning dining rm opens to outside. 4 spacious bedrms, newly remodeled master bath 2019 w/adjoining walk-in closet. Stunning original wide plank hardwood flrs throughout. New HVAC 2018, over-sized 2 car garage w/utility sink, nature stone flooring. One of Hudson's finest & most historically significant homes located in heart of village. Beautifully restored & maintained. New patio w/gas fireplace (2019), landscaping, koi pond/waterfall, lighting, sound-Red tile clay roof-so much to offer! New custom bathrms, upstairs and downstairs, w/custom glass, original brick, custom quartz and custom tile designs 2021.

Regarded as the “jewel” of northeastern Ohio, Hudson is a picturesque suburb teeming with small-town charm between Cleveland and Akron. Hudson is known for its top-notch schools, historic neighborhoods, upscale shopping and dining options, and overall peaceful atmosphere.
Hudson is home to a vibrant downtown area, where local shops and restaurants populate rows of well-preserved historic buildings. Additional shopping opportunities abound at nearby Aurora Farms Premium Outlets. Hudson is also proximate to a host of outdoor fun at Hudson Springs Park, Cuyahoga Valley National Park, and numerous golf and country clubs. Convenience to the Ohio Turnpike and I-480 makes getting around from Hudson simple.
